In modern software development, one of the key tasks is to choose the appropriate architecture for the system in the early stages of its design. This article examines two popular software architecture approaches: service-oriented architecture (SOA) and microservice architecture (MSA). Based on the analysis of architectural features, advantages and disadvantages of these approaches, the criteria that influence the choice of an architectural model depending on the specifics of the system are investigated. Microservice architecture, due to its independence and the possibility of rapid scaling, is better suited for dynamic systems with high requirements for flexibility. Service-oriented architecture, on the contrary, is focused on centralized management of services through ESB (Enterprise Service Bus) and provides better opportunities for integration and reuse of components in large corporate systems that do not require frequent changes in functionality. The main focus of the article is the development of an evaluation method that will allow software developers and system engineers to determine at the early design stages which of the architectures, SOA or MSA, is more appropriate to use for a specific system. Taking into account various technical and requirements, the method identifies key criteria that should be paid attention to when choosing an application software architecture.

It is well known that, at the present, a huge amount of information, often referred as Big Data, is processed by each domain of modern society. Big data are well defined by the seven dimensions: Volume, Velocity, Variety, Variability, Veracity, Visualization and Value. The traditional database management systems cannot handle the requirements of high availability, scalability and reliability emerged with Big Data. The good news is that we are now in the age of NoSQL databases. NoSQL do not have a fixed structure, they have a flexible structure and are suited for storing unstructured data produced in a large scale in various field. This work outlines the four main types of NoSQL databases and presents some of their representative solutions.

Applications of science and technology have made a human life much easier. Vision plays a very important role in one’s life. Disease, accidents or due some other reasons people may loose their vision. Navigation becomes a major problem for the people with complete blindness or partial blindness. This paper aims to provide navigation guidance for visually impaired. Here we have designed a model which provides the instruction for the visionless people to navigate freely. NoIR camera is used to capture the picture around the person and identifies the objects. Using earphones voice output is provided defining the objects. This model includes Raspberry Pi 3 processor which collects the objects in surroundings and converts them into voice message, NoIR camera is used detect the object, power bank provides the power and earphones are used here the output message. TensorFlow API an open source software library used for object detection and classification. Using TensorFlow API multiple objects are obtained in a single frame. eSpeak a Text to Speech synthesizer (TTS) software is used to convert text (detected objects) to speech format. Hence using NoIR camera video which is captured is converted into voice output which provides the guidance for detecting objects. Using COCO model 90 commonly used objects are identified like person, table, book etc.
